iwlwifi: Fix memory leaks in error handling path
[ Upstream commit a571bc28326d9f3e13f5f2d9cda2883e0631b0ce ] Should an error occur (invalid TLV len or memory allocation failure), the memory already allocated in 'reduce_power_data' should be freed before returning, otherwise it is leaking.
